Introduction

Shoe Bending waterproof test machine is use to inspect shoes immersion resistance and bending resistance of the water

 

Standard

SATRA TM77,TM92, GB/T 16441

FAQs of Shoe Bending Waterproof Test Machine:


Q: How does the Shoe Bending Waterproof Test Machine work to evaluate footwear waterproof resistance?

A: The machine simulates real-world flexing conditions by bending shoe specimens at adjustable angles (5 to 45) within a leak-proof chamber while water is applied using an integrated tray. It records cycles until water penetrates or the preset test range is complete, accurately assessing the footwears waterproof performance.

Q: What types and sizes of footwear can be tested using this equipment?

A: This machine can test up to four pairs (eight pieces) per batch, accommodating maximum specimen dimensions of 200 mm x 60 mm. It is suitable for most adult or childrens footwear types commonly used in industry testing.
